Installation Tips to Get the Best from Your Yamaha YZF-R125 Full Stainless System 2008 – 2013
Getting the most out of your new exhaust starts with a proper installation. Here are some practical tips from the team at Max Torque Cans:
- Apply copper grease to all threaded fixings — this prevents thread seizure caused by heat cycling, making future removal far easier.
- Loosely assemble all components first — before tightening anything fully, assemble the entire exhaust loosely to ensure everything lines up correctly. Then tighten progressively from the header flange down.
- Allow the exhaust to heat-cycle before riding hard — after installation, allow the bike to warm up and cool down a couple of times before pushing it. This allows the metal to expand and contract naturally and settles all the joints.
- Check all fixings after the first ride — vibration can work fasteners slightly loose after initial use. A quick once-over after your first run will ensure everything remains tight and secure.
- Avoid cleaning products on a hot exhaust — allow the stainless to cool completely before applying any polish or cleaning agent.

To Make sure that you are shopping for the correct Model exhaust here is some information about this model.
The Yamaha YZF-R125 is a sport motorcycle designed by Yamaha and manufactured by MBK Industrie since 2008. It currently has 3 generations.
First generation: (2008 – 2013)
In 2008, the bike initially came available as a four-stroke replacement for the TZR125. Entering the thin market of small displacement 4-stroke sportbikes, it quickly gained traction and became a popular choice for young riders.
Second generation: (2014 -2018)
In 2014, Yamaha unveiled a facelifted version of the bike with a slightly tweaked fairing set, an upside-down front fork, and a full LCD dashboard.
It launched without ABS, but it became an option for 2015 and comes as standard equipment on all bikes since 2017. This may cause minor differences in weight and electrical or other specifications.
In 2016, the LCD instrument received a minor revision, in which the segment arrangement for various gauges has been slightly modified, including a horizontal tacho instead of a vertical one.
Third generation: (2019 – on)
The 2019 revision brings some major changes: New rear swingarm, tweaked frame, rebuilt cowling, a new engine with Variable Valve Actuation (VVA), and many other minor modifications add up to a brand new construction. With this release, Yamaha brings it’s R-series superbikes aesthetically more or less in line with each other.
The top speed on the factory version of the Yamaha YZF-R125 is 85 mph (137kmh)
Specifications
Dimensions Overall length 1950 mm
Overall width 695 mm
Overall height 1065 mm
Seat height 825 mm
Wheelbase 1350 mm
Ground clearance 155 mm
Turning radius 3100 mm
Front brake Disc Floating, 292 mm
Caliper Fixed, 4 pistons, Radial mount
Engine Type Liquid-cooled, 4-stroke, SOHC
Displacement 124.7 cc
Bore x Stroke 52.0 x 58.6 mm
Compression ratio 11.2 : 1
Weight Fuel capacity 11.5 l
Oil capacity 1.15 l (1.0 l after filter change)
Coolant capacity 1.0 l (+0.25 l reservoir)
Curb weight (with fuel) 143 kg
